The Spa Pavilion Theatre, Felixstowe has today announced “The Wiz” as their Summer Youth Project for 2009.
Now in its seventh year, the increasingly popular Summer Youth Project provides an opportunity for budding young stars in the local area aged between 9 and 23 to stage and perform a full-scale musical under expert professional supervision.
Over a two week period the cast are put through an intensive rehearsal schedule, learning all stage techniques including performance, lighting, sound and music. In the second week the show is performed to the paying public in full costume.
Julie Howes, General Manager “Choosing a musical for the summer youth project is not an easy task and there are many hurdles to cross before a decision can be made. Whether or not a particular show is available to perform can be the most problematic then there are other considerations such as whether it will be suitable for the amount of young people involved (around 130) and whether or not we think it will be popular with audiences”
The Wiz is based on the well known story of The Wonderful Wizard of Oz. This particular musical version is mysterious, lavish and fanciful - with Dorothy's adventures in the Land of Oz set to music in a dazzling, lively mixture of rock, gospel and soul.
Julie Howes “We have always had a great production team working on the project and this year will see the return of Rebecca Darcy as Director, Richard Healey as Musical Director and Suzie Lowe as Choreographer”
Julie went on to say “The important factors of any Summer Youth Project is that it covers all elements of musical theatre and that it is fun to do – I think the success of the previous six projects has confirmed just that”
